Shoppers are rushing to Schuh to take advantage of a £5 voucher that can be earned by recycling old shoes. The footwear retailer is giving away vouchers to anyone who brings in a pair of shoes, regardless of where they were purchased.

The Only Catch

The only limitation is that you can only use one voucher per pair of new shoes. Schuh's terms and conditions state, "Customers handing in a pair of unwanted used shoes into a Schuh store will receive a £5 Schuh voucher to spend in UK stores or online. Vouchers can be redeemed against full-price items over £25 only."

Find a Schuh Store Near You

Schuh has nearly 200 locations across the UK, with London, Glasgow, and Sheffield leading the way. The first store opened in Edinburgh in 1991. Schuh specializes in selling branded footwear from a range of popular brands, including Uggs, Doc Martens, Nike, and Adidas.
